Capiz builds first Emergency Operation Center in Region 6

Residents use a boat to ferry them around a flood-hit village in Capiz province, in this Jan. 3, 2018 photo. The construction of the three-storey P45-million Aksyon Tabang Emergency Operation Center cum Evacuation Center is expected to be completed in July 2020. CAPIZ AKSYON NEWS CENTER

ROXAS City – The construction of a three-storey P45-million Aksyon Tabang Emergency Operation Center has started here.

The blessing and groundbreaking ceremony, Jan. 21, at ESLA in Barangay Lanot, here, was led by Governor Antonio Del Rosario.

He was joined by Office of Civil Defense (OCD)-6 regional director Jose Roberto Nuñez, assistant division commander Brigadier General Erick Vinoya of the Philippine Army’s 3rd Infantry Division, Western Visayas Coast Guard District Acting commander Captain Allan Victor Dela Vega and other local and national government officials.

The construction of the Emergency Operation Center cum Evacuation Center costing more than P30.77-million is expected to be completed in July 2020; however, Del Rosario appeals to the contractor to speed up the activity and finish the work ahead of the schedule.

In his message, Nuñez lauded Governor Del Rosario for giving much importance to the strengthening of Disaster Risk Reduction and Management program and for the all-out support to the Provincial DRRM Office in Capiz led by PDRRM Officer Judy Grace Pelaez.

He said the Aksyon Tabang Emergency Operation Center in Capiz is the first in Panay Island and in Western Visayas.

“I hope that the other LGUs in Capiz and in the rest of the region will follow what the provincial government of Capiz has done,” he said.

On the other hand, Del Rosario said his administration is doing programs and projects that will help the Capiceños especially during disasters and emergencies.

He said that in his less than three years of   service as governor, the province was able to purchase seven units of brand new ambulance,  three units rescue speed boats, repaired the hospitals, heavy equipment, implemented scholarship programs, salary increase, among others.

Del Rosario also noted the dedication, commitment and sincerity of the staff of the PDRRMO and members of the Capiz Emergency Response Team in the delivery of their services to help others especially during emergencies.

The Governor also urged everyone including those in the public and private sectors to do what is good for the government and for the people.

Part of the ceremony was the ceremonial turnover by Del Rosario to Dela Vega of the P2.9-million high end speedboat for the Philippine Coast Guard Station- Capiz.

Meanwhile, Pelaez thanked Del Rosario for making into a reality this dream Emergency Operation Center cum Evacuation Center that will serve as the coordination hub for incident response. (PIA/PN)
